Accruals During Layoff Sample Clauses

Accruals During Layoff. An employee who is laid off because a position is abolished or because of a lack of funds, shall not accrue sick leave during the period of layoff. All accumulated sick leave shall be held for the employee’s credit should he/she return to work during the period provided for restoration or layoff re-employment.

Accruals During Layoff. Status While an employee is on layoff status, he/she shall not accrue vacation, personal leave, sick, or longevity increases. Any employee laid off from City employment will be offered the opportunity to receive a cash out payment for banked vacation, personal or compensatory time at the time of the layoff. If the employee chooses not to take an immediate payout, his/her banks will be retained by the City for up to six (6) months and will be made available to the employee if he or she is recalled to work within that six (6) month period. If the employee is not recalled within six (6) months, the payout of the accrued vacation, personal or compensatory time will be made at that time. The City will maintain a laid off employee’s sick bank during the entire period of layoff. If the employee is recalled from layoff, his/her sick leave bank will be restored.

  • Benefits During Layoff Temporary Full-Time and Regular Full-Time Employees who have gained seniority rights and who are laid off from employment due to lack of work shall be entitled to leave without pay status until the end of the calendar month following the month during which layoff occurs, for purpose of continuing coverage under the Health and Welfare Benefit plans on which they have been enrolled, e.g., B.C. Medical, Extended Health, Dental Plan, Group Life Insurance, Long Term Total Disability Plan, and Optional Additional Life Insurance coverage. The City agrees to ensure that such leave without pay status and benefit coverage continues in effect at the employee's cost during such period, provided that such cost is paid in advance by or recovered from the employee concerned.

  • Sick Leave During Vacation Where an employee qualifies for sick leave due to illness or injury during the period of vacation time, sick leave shall displace vacation leave. An illness or injury occurring while the employee is on scheduled vacation time shall not be accepted as a claim for sick leave benefits unless recuperation involves hospitalization or confinement to bed by order of a medical practitioner. Written medical verification of such illness or injury and hospitalization or confinement must be provided to the Employer in order for the employee to be eligible for sick leave benefits.

  • Sick Leave During Leave of Absence (F/T) When an Employee is given leave of absence without pay for any reason, or is laid off on account of lack of work, he/she shall not continue to accumulate sick leave and shall not be entitled to receive pay for sickness for the period of such absence, but shall retain his/her cumulative credit, if any, existing at the time of such leave or lay-off.
